As the Regional Senior Auditor, World Vision DRC, you will provide technical supervision, support and coordination of the Region’s Internal Auditors, as well as performing managerial duties in the absence of, or as delegated by the Regional Audit Managers (RAMs). In addition, you will provide an independent objective assurance and consulting activity designed to add value and improve the organization’s operations. This will be done by using a systematic approach to evaluate and improve the effectiveness of risk management, internal control and governance processes of the Organization.

 

Requirements include:

 

  • Bachelor's degree or higher in Finance or Accounting or Business Administration.
  • At least five (5) years’ experience in audit.
  • Exposure to various audit management and /or accounting systems Experience in terms of assisting with the development and/or improvement of audit methodologies.
  • Technical professional certification required i.e. CISM, CRISC, CPA Certified - Public Accountant) or CIA (Certified Internal Auditor) or CA (Chartered - Accountant).
  • Computer skills (office applications, accounting systems and audit tools)
  • Fluent French and English language skills (Bilingual)
  • Position Location: Kinshasa, Democratic Republic of the Congo (DRC)
